The History and Myth of Albert Einstein's Education

The history of Albert Einstein's education is often overshadowed by the myth surrounding his genius. Contrary to popular belief, Einstein was not a poor student or a high school dropout. While it is true that he struggled with traditional schooling methods, he was always intellectually curious and had a deep fascination with math and science.

Einstein's journey in education began at a young age when he developed a keen interest in mathematics. However, his unconventional thinking and rebellious nature clashed with the rigid structure of the educational system. This led to tensions with his teachers and a sense of frustration and disinterest in formal education.

Despite his difficulties with traditional schooling, Einstein's education continued outside the classroom. He spent hours reading books on science and math, conducting experiments, and engaging in intellectual discussions with his peers and mentors. This self-directed learning allowed him to explore his interests freely and develop his unique perspective on the world.
